“Trouble is a Lonesome Town” (released 1963) was Lee Hazlewood’s first bona fide solo album. An original blend of spoken narrative alongside yarns in song, about the fictional town of Trouble and its offbeat characters. The album presaged Lee’s later success with Nancy Sinatra, and his subsequent lengthy career. It still resonates in 2023 and stands as a countrypolitan classic.

THE STU THOMAS PARADOX will celebrate the 60th anniversary of this Iconic release, performing the entire album (and then some) with some of Melbourne’s finest musicians.
